Sha256: a56fc8bc02f99e96b2abb8a7e8f37a3d51cebedec7edadc3b9dfc6dd37386d60

Contents?: true

Size: 415 Bytes

Versions: 4

Compression:

Stored size: 415 Bytes

Contents

import "../selection/each";
import "transition";

d3_transitionPrototype.duration = function(value) {
  var id = this.id;
  return d3_selection_each(this, typeof value === "function"
      ? function(node, i, j) { node.__transition__[id].duration = Math.max(1, value.call(node, node.__data__, i, j) | 0); }
      : (value = Math.max(1, value | 0), function(node) { node.__transition__[id].duration = value; }));
};

Version data entries

4 entries across 4 versions & 2 rubygems

Version Path
stripchart-0.0.3 lib/stripchart/public/components/d3/src/transition/duration.js
stripmem-0.0.3 lib/stripmem/public/components/d3/src/transition/duration.js
stripmem-0.0.2 lib/stripmem/public/components/d3/src/transition/duration.js
stripmem-0.0.1 lib/stripmem/public/components/d3/src/transition/duration.js